NF-κB inhibitor interacting Ras-like 2 is a protein that in humans is encoded by the NKIRAS2 gene.[1]

Model organisms

Model organisms have been used in the study of NKIRAS2 function. A conditional knockout mouse line, called Nkiras2tm1a(EUCOMM)Wtsi[4][5] was generated as part of the International Knockout Mouse Consortium program — a high-throughput mutagenesis project to generate and distribute animal models of disease to interested scientists.[6][7][8]

Male and female animals underwent a standardized phenotypic screen to determine the effects of deletion.[3][9] Twenty one tests were carried out, but no significant abnormalities were observed.[3]
